Army Parachutist Survives Drop During Display

An Army parachutist has survived with 'minor grazes' after his display jump went wrong, and he fell 5,000 feet to the ground.

It happened at the Eastbourne Air Show at the weekend. 

The parachutist was believed to be from The Tigers Army Parachute Display Team, Princess of Wales Royal Regiment.

The regiment has been contacted for comment.

His teammates landed in the water, while he spiralled to the ground below.

Daniel Blocksidge was visiting a nearby beach with his family, when he noticed the situation in the sky and took footage on his mobile phone.

He told Forces News, "I was surprised they jumped as the winds were really strong.

"I knew he was in trouble, he didn't look in control."

He described the incident as "a lucky escape."
